Understanding Luxury Jet Hire Cost Analysis: Elements & Projections

Determining the final expense of renting a charter plane is rarely straightforward; it's a complex equation influenced by numerous factors. Hourly prices form the foundation, typically ranging from $3,000 to $18,000 for 60-minute block, and dramatically fluctuate depending on the jet size. Aircraft size is a significant driver – a light jet will be considerably less expensive than a heavy, long-range jet. Extra costs include fuel, crew wages, field fees, servicing, deicing (in cold weather), catering, and ground travel. Lastly, flight path and flight time have a substantial impact on the overall price. An simple round-trip journey might cost several thousand dollars, while a overseas voyage readily climbs into tens or even hundreds of thousands.

Charter Cost Directory: From Light Aircraft to Large Aircraft

Understanding jet travel costs can feel complex, but a general guide can help. Light jets, like the Citation CJ3 or Learjet 45, typically start around $3,500 to $6,000 each journey hour, incorporating fuel and crew expenses. Mid-size jets, like a Hawker 800XP or a Gulfstream G150, command fees extending from approximately $6,000 to $9,500 each journey hour. For those needing significant capacity and reach capabilities, heavy jets, such as a Gulfstream G650 or a Bombardier Global 7500, represent the highest level of chartered travel, with per-hour fees generally exceeding $12,000 and even reaching $20,000 or more. Keep in mind that these are approximations and real pricing may vary based on factors like distance length, petrol rates, field fees, plane status, and request. It is always to get a specific quote directly from a charter operator.
